Here is the obit you requested for the following person: PEEK CLEO born: 02/26/1908 M OKLAHOMA died: KERN 03/04/1973 age: 65 yrs requested by: marge@plateautel.net Message board The Bakersfield Californian Tuesday, March 6, 1973 Pg. 28 PEEK, Cleo - Military graveside services will be held at 10 a.m. Thursday at Forest Lawn, Glendale, for Cleo Peek, 65, 224 McCord Avenue, who died March 4 in a Bakersfield hospital. Military personal and members of the VFW will officiate. Mr. Peek was born in Cushing, Okla., and had lived in Kern County for the past 37 years. Mr. Peek is survived by his wife, Clara, of Bakersfield; 2 daughters, Mrs. Marie Reed of Glendale and Mrs. Dena Savage of La Mirada; sister, Mrs. Lucille Suther of San Jose and 6 grandchildren. Mr. Peek was a veteran of WW2 and served in Italy. He was a member of the famous Blue Devils and was the recipient of the silver star with an oak leaf cluster, medal of honor unit citation, and many other medals. Here is the obit you requested for the following person: JAMIESON PRYOR FREDRIC born: 09/05/1894 M TEXAS died: KERN 02/13/1993 age: 98 yrs requested by: pdwright@softtrakz.com The Bakersfield Californian February 16, 1993 Pryor "Fred" JAMIESON Service 2 p.m., February 17 Graveside services will be held at 2 p.m. Wednesday at the Hillcrest Memorial Park for Fred "Grandad" Jamieson, 98, of Bakersfield who passed away February 13. Fred was born in Aquilla, Texas on Sept. 5, 1894 and came to California in 1926. He settled in the Taft-Maricopa area in 1935, at which time he worked for the Alford Oil Company. In 1950 Fred and his two son, T. L. Jamieson and Jay Jamieson, began a farming operation in the Maricopa Flats area. Fred retired from farming in 1961. Throughout his life, Fred and his loving wife Bea were avid Western horse enthusiasts. They took many trips into the High Sierras back country. For many years, Fred was an active participant in various local rodeo and horse events. Fred was preceded kin death by his wife Beulah and sons T. L. Jamieson and Jay Jamieson. He is survived by his grandsons, Tom Jamieson and wife Terri of Bakersfield, Bernie Jamieson of Bakersfield, Pat Jamieson of Taft and Scott Jamieson of Barstow, granddaughters Carole Artale and husband T. J. of Costa Mesa, and Traci Jamieson of Bakersfield; and daughter-in-law Lillian Jamieson of Newport Beach, CA. Fred will be missed by the many people whose lives he touched.
